In China, facial recognition is sharp end of big data drive for total surveillance - The Washington Post: Facial recognition is the new hot tech topic in China. Banks, airports, hotels and even public toilets are all trying to verify people’s identities by analyzing their faces. But the police and security state have been the most enthusiastic about embracing this new technology.

MNLF, MILF form alliance vs ISIS-inspired groups | Malaya Business Insight: PALIMBANG, Sultan Kudarat. – Two major Islamic groups which have signed peace agreements with government -- the Moro National Liberation Front (MNLF) and the Moro Islamic Liberation Front (MILF) -- agreed here on Saturday on a joint action against ISIS-inspired militant groups reportedly operating in the Central Mindanao region.

Clan wars testing Duterte martial law | Inquirer News: ILIGAN CITY — A clan war that had wounded four people in a Lanao del Sur town is testing President Rodrigo Duterte’s martial law in Mindanao, which supposedly bans carrying of firearms except for law enforcers on duty.

Robredo: ‘No-el’ scenario self-serving | Inquirer News: “Where’s the democracy in that?‘ Vice President Leni Robredo raised this question on Sunday as she opposed the “no-election (No-el)” scenario in 2019 being floated by leaders of Congress to pave the way for a shift to a federal form of government.
